Apple has introduced a brand new iPad Pro, a redesigned 12.9-inch model that features an updated camera, LiDAR scanner, A12Z Bionic chip, and a true cursor experience with the new Magic Keyboard with Trackpad. This is one of the best iPads that Apple has ever made. All of this means that there are some brand new accessories to think about, and here are some of the best 12.9 iPad Pro accessories out there.

A magical experience

Magic Keyboard for iPad Pro

Staff Favorite

Available in May, this delightful accessory includes a trackpad for precision control of the cursor on your iPad. The floating cantilever design lets you adjust your iPad to your perfect angle for typing. The Magic Keyboard is compatible with both the 2018 and 2020 iPad Pro models, making it one of the best 12.9 iPad Pro accessories you can buy.

Charge and go

Anker USB-C to Lightning cable (6ft MFi Certified)

One of the neat little tricks of the iPad Pro (2018 or 2020) is that it can charge your iPhone on its own using a USB-C to Lightning cable. This USB-C to Lightning cable from Anker allows just that at a lower price than Apple's official cable.

Mulitple ports

HyperDrive 6-in-1 USB-C Hub for iPad Pro

One port isn't enough, so how does six sound? Hyper offers this little hub gem, which turns your single USB-C port into a 3.5mm audio Jack, USB-A port, SD card slot, microSD card slot, USB-C port, and HDMI port.
